Abstract

The utility model discloses a pedal type parking brake mechanism for a forklift, comprising a brake mechanism and a brake-eliminating mechanism. A parking brake foot brake bracket (5) is installed ona vehicle body instrument stand; a reset tension spring (4) leads a parking brake foot brake (1) to be linked with the parking brake foot brake bracket (5); a reset tension spring (3) leads a parkingbrake foot brake limit mechanism (2) to be linked with the parking brake foot brake bracket (5); a hanging block (9) is connected with the parking brake foot brake (1) through a hanging and pulling hinge shaft (7) and an adjusting screw rod (8); and the brake-eliminating mechanism (10) is connected with the parking brake foot brake limit mechanism (2) through a parking brake brake-eliminating steel wire rope (6). The pedal type parking brake mechanism for the forklift adopts the structure and changes the original manual manipulation to be pedal type manipulation, and the whole operation conforms to the principle of ergonomics, thus reducing the force-implementing strength of operators and improving the comfort of the operators.

Background technology
At present, in the fork truck technical field, existing fork truck stopping brake mechanism all is the hand operation braking, hand brake operation mechanism generally is installed on the preceding instrument calibration side far away from the operator, because need be when stopping with pulling moving stopping brake mechanism, could operate so the operator need bend over to lean forward, its operating effort reaches operation application of force attitude more greatly and not really meets ergonomics, so its handling comfort is relatively poor.

The specific embodiment
By accompanying drawing as can be known, this kind fork truck comprises that with foot-operated stopping brake mechanism stop mechanism and un-brake mechanism form, described stop mechanism is foot-operated stop mechanism, its stopping brake service brake support 5 is installed on the car body instrument calibration, stopping brake service brake 1, stopping brake service brake stop gear 2 is installed in stopping brake service brake support 5 left sides, reset tension spring 4 connects stopping brake service brake 1 and stopping brake service brake support 5, reduction torsion spring 3 connects stopping brake service brake stop gear 2 and stopping brake service brake support 5, hanging piece 9 is installed on the stopping brake service brake support 5, draw hinge 7 by hanging, adjusting screw(rod) 8 is connected with stopping brake service brake 1, stopping brake steel rope 11 is installed on the stopping brake service brake support 5, its terminal with hang piece 9 and be connected, stopping brake un-brake steel rope 6 is installed on the stopping brake service brake support 5, its end is connected with stopping brake service brake stop gear 2, un-brake mechanism 10 is installed on the fork-truck steering tubing string, is connected with stopping brake service brake stop gear 2 by stopping brake un-brake steel rope 6.Implement glancing impact, when stepping on stopping brake service brake 1 along the direction of arrow, piece 9 and 11 motions of stopping brake steel rope are hung and are drawn hinge 7, adjusting screw(rod) 8, hang in 1 drive of stopping brake service brake, when stopping brake service brake 1 moves to certain position, stopping brake service brake stop gear 2 blocks stopping brake service brake 1 under the spring force effect of reduction torsion spring 3, stopping brake service brake 1 is pinned, thereby make the work of fork truck drg realize its parking brake function; When removing parking brake function, handle un-brake mechanism 10 along the direction of arrow, drive 2 actions of stopping brake service brake stop gear by stopping brake un-brake steel rope 6, make stopping brake service brake 1 under the spring force effect of reset tension spring 4, break away from locking state, realize removing parking brake function thereby make the fork truck drg remove mode of operation.
